Our verdict is Likely benign. Variant got -3 ACMG points: 1P and 4B. PP3BS2
The NM_001105581.3(LRRC30):c.139G>A(p.Gly47Ser) variant causes a missense change. The variant allele was found at a frequency of 0.0000632 in 1,614,090 control chromosomes in the GnomAD database, with no homozygous occurrence. In-silico tool predicts a pathogenic outcome for this variant. Variant has been reported in ClinVar as Uncertain significance (★).

The c.139G>A (p.G47S) alteration is located in exon 1 (coding exon 1) of the LRRC30 gene. This alteration results from a G to A substitution at nucleotide position 139, causing the glycine (G) at amino acid position 47 to be replaced by a serine (S). Based on insufficient or conflicting evidence, the clinical significance of this alteration remains unclear. -
